局域网常见子网掩码错误解析与解决

LEAF
局域网中子网掩码错误是常见网络故障,主要表现为掩码位数与IP地址不匹配、配置不一致导致通信异常,C类IP(如192.168.1.x)误用255.0.0.0掩码,会使广播域过大,引发广播风暴;或误用255.255.255.0导致子网划分过细,浪费IP资源,不同设备掩码配置差异,会引发跨网段通信失败,解决方法需先核对IP地址类别与掩码匹配性(如A类用/8,B类用/16,C类常用/24),再根据网络规模调整掩码位数,统一交换机、路由器等设备配置,确保网关与终端掩码一致,正确配置子网掩码,可有效优化网络结构,提升通信效率与稳定性。

子网掩码是局域网通信中的“隐形指挥官”,它通过与IP地址“按位与”运算,区分出网络部分和主机部分,决定数据包是在本地网络转发还是跨网段传输,在实际配置中,子网掩码错误却屡见不鲜,轻则导致部分设备无法通信,重则引发整个网络瘫痪,本文将梳理局域网中常见的子网掩码错误,分析其成因与影响,并提供具体解决方法。

子网掩码的重要性:网络通信的“分界线”

要理解掩码错误,需先明确其核心作用,以IP地址192.168.1.100为例,若掩码为255.255.255.0(即/24),通过“按位与”运算可得网络地址为192.168.1.0——这意味着该设备与所有192.168.1.x网段的设备直接通信,而与其他网段(如192.168.2.x)的通信需通过网关转发,若掩码配置错误,这一“分界线”就会模糊,导致设备无法判断通信范围,进而引发故障。

局域网常见子网掩码错误解析与解决

局域网常见子网掩码错误及解析

掩码位数过高,可用主机数不足

原因:误认为“掩码位数越高,网络越大”,实际掩码位数越高,主机位数越少,可用IP地址越少。/30掩码(255.255.255.252)仅提供2个可用主机地址(网络地址和广播地址不可用),适合点对点链路(如路由器互联),但若用于普通办公网络(需接入数十台设备),必然导致IP枯竭。

局域网常见子网掩码错误解析与解决

现象:新接入设备获取IP后无法通信,或频繁弹出“IP地址冲突”提示(因DHCP分配的IP耗尽,设备可能重复使用已分配IP)。

案例:某公司办公室有30台电脑,管理员误将掩码设为/30,结果仅2台设备能接入网络,其余设备无法获取有效IP。

解决方法:根据主机数量计算合适的掩码位数,公式为:主机位数n需满足2^n - 2 ≥ 主机数量(-2是扣除网络地址和广播地址),30台设备需5位主机(2^5-2=30),对应掩码为/27(255.255.255.224)。

掩码位数过低,广播域过大引发性能瓶颈

原因:为“扩大网络范围”将掩码设得过低(如/16),导致广播域过大,广播包(如ARP请求)会在整个广播域内泛洪,占用大量带宽,引发网络卡顿。

现象:网络整体速度缓慢,网页打开延迟高,ping命令丢包严重。

案例:某学校机房将200台电脑的掩码统一设为/16(255.255.0.0),任何一台设备发送广播包时,其余199台均需处理,导致机房网络在上课时段频繁瘫痪。

解决方法:按部门或楼层划分子网,使用中等长度的掩码(如/24或/25),将200台设备分为4个子网(每网50台),掩码设为/26(255.255.255.192),每个子网广播域独立,避免广播风暴。

掩码与IP地址类不匹配,导致网络划分错误

原因:未考虑IP地址的默认类別,随意配置掩码,A类IP(1.0.0.0-126.255.255.255)默认掩码为/8(255.0.0.0),若误用/24掩码,会将原网络错误拆分为多个子网,导致设备无法识别自身网络范围。

现象:设备无法 ping 通同网段其他设备,或误将其他网段设备视为本地设备,通信失败。

案例:某设备IP为10.1.1.100(A类),管理员误将掩码设为255.255.255.0(/24),导致设备认为自身网络为10.1.1.0,而实际A类默认网络为10.0.0.0,无法与10.1.1网段外的设备通信。

解决方法:根据IP地址类别选择默认掩码,或通过子网划分重新规划,A类默认/8,B类(128.0.0.0-191.255.255.255)默认/16,C类(192.0.0.0-223.255.255.255)默认/24,若需子网划分,可在默认掩码基础上“借位”主机位作为子网位(如C类/24借3位变为/27)。

不同网段掩码不一致,跨网段通信失败

原因:在路由网络中,各子网掩码未统一,导致路由器无法正确判断目标网络,子网A掩码/24,子网B掩码/25,路由器收到目标IP为192.168.2.130的数据包时,可能因掩码不一致误判目标网络,无法转发。

现象:部分子网间无法互访,例如子网A能访问子网B的192.168.2.1,但无法访问192.168.2.130(因掩码导致路由表匹配错误)。

案例:某公司分为销售部(192.168.1.0/24)和技术部(192.168.2.0/25),销售部无法访问技术部的192.168.2.130(技术部掩码/25,网络范围为192.168.2.0-192.168.2.127),因路由器认为192.168.2.130不属于技术部网络。

解决方法:统一各子网掩码,或在路由器上配置“超网”(Supernetting)或静态路由,确保掩码与目标网络匹配,将技术部掩码改为/24,与销售部一致,或通过静态路由指定192.168.2.130/25的下一跳。

手动配置掩码输入错误,导致网络参数失效

原因:管理员手动配置IP时,误输掩码(如将255.255.255.0输成255.255.0.255,或输入无效值如255.255.255.256),掩码必须是“连续的1后跟连续的0”(二进制),否则系统无法识别。

现象:设备显示“IP地址配置失败”,或无法 ping 通网关,本地连接频繁断开。

案例:某员工手动配置电脑IP时,将掩码误输为255.255.0.255(非连续1/0),导致系统无法计算网络地址,无法接入网络。

解决方法:手动配置时仔细检查掩码格式,确保为“连续1+连续0”(如255.255.255.0、255.255.240.0);优先使用DHCP自动分配IP和掩码,减少人为错误;配置后通过ipconfig(Windows)或ifconfig(Linux)命令验证掩码是否正确。

如何避免子网掩码错误?

  1. 提前规划网络:根据设备数量、网段需求,使用子网计算工具(如“子网计算器”)确定合适的掩码位数,避免随意配置。
  2. 启用DHCP:通过DHCP服务器统一分配IP、掩码、网关,减少手动配置错误;对需固定IP的设备(如服务器),使用DHCP保留IP功能。
  3. 定期验证配置:使用pingtracert(Windows)或traceroute(Linux)测试网络连通性,通过arp -a查看ARP表是否正常,及时发现掩码异常。
  4. 文档化管理:记录网络拓扑、IP地址分配表、掩码配置等,便于故障排查和后续维护。

子网掩码虽小,却是局域网通信的“基石”,一次错误的掩码配置,可能引发连锁故障,只有理解其原理、规范配置流程、加强日常维护,才能让“隐形指挥官”真正发挥作用,保障局域网稳定运行,在网络运维中,细节决定成败,对子网掩码的精准把控,正是从“故障频发”到“稳定高效”的关键一步。

文章版权声明:除非注明,否则均为XMSDN - MSDN原版系统镜像 | 纯净ISO系统下载原创文章,转载或复制请以超链接形式并注明出处。

取消
微信二维码
微信二维码
支付宝二维码